Two swords "mandau" (or "parang ilang") with scabbards

Indonesia - Borneo, Kalimantan, Dayak

a) “mandau” with bone handle, iron blade with brass inlays, wooden and palm leaf sheath, decorated with goat hair, plant fibre plaits and bamboo sticks, l: 71.5 cm

b) “mandau” with wooden handle, iron blade with incised scrolls and brass inlays, wooden and palm leaf sheath, decorated with goat hair and plaited plant fibres, l: 70 cm
